I smoked for 40+ years, and never tried to quit before last July 4.  I listened to my addicted mind and the brainwashing that said I was not strong enough.  With the help of Chantix, Allen Carr's book and the folks on this site, I have not smoked a cigarette or inhaled one puff from one in SIX MONTHS!

You all should understand that it is not easy, but it IS doable.  You need to do your reading and preparation work, and commit to the effort 100%.  If you do, though, I promise you will be successful.  If I can do this, EVERYONE can!

Just DO it!
